1 definition by Some Jobless Genius

Top Definition
The most kind hearted, honest, trustworthy person you'll even meet. If you find him then he's certainly a keeper. This person is a gem among gems and is truly a blessing but the secret is that he doesn't know it yet!
Omg! You are so lucky, you found Nayeem!
by Some Jobless Genius October 18, 2019

Mug icon
Buy a Nayeem mug!